LAWRENCE, Kan. -
Jeff Davis limited UWM to just one run over six innings and Matt Tribble cracked a two-run homer in the bottom of the sixth to lift Kansas to a 4-1 win over UWM Friday afternoon in the Panthers' season opener.
Aaron Bushong (0-1) allowed just two runs in his first five innings of work but was knocked out of the game in the sixth by Tribble's two-run homer. While the Panther bullpen then held Kansas scoreless the rest of the way, the UWM offense could never muster more than a John Vanden Berg RBI single in the first.
Vanden Berg was the only Panther with more the one hit in the game. Newcomer Geoff Lefeber and senior Matt Freisleben tossed three scoreless innings in relief for UWM
The Jayhawks (6-0) and Panthers (0-1) will play a doubleheader Saturday beginning at 1 p.m.
